A professionally drafted Will ensures your wishes are followed after your death. It allows you to decide:

> Who inherits your money, property and possessions

> Who will care for your children

> Who will administer your estate

Without a valid Will, the law determines how your estate is distributed, which may not reflect your wishes.

A professionally written Will gives you control, clarity and peace of mind.

Mirror Wills

A popular option for couples, spouses and civil partners who wish to leave their estate to each other and ultimately to shared beneficiaries such as children.

Mirror Wills are designed for couples who want their estate plans to reflect the same outcomes. Both Wills are written at the same time, usually with similar wording. They provide an easy method for couples to express shared decisions, like guardianship of children or how property will be handled.

However, Mirror Wills are not legally linked. This means one partner can change their Will after the other’s death, which might affect the original agreement. You should only choose Mirror Wills if you both fully trust each other to maintain the plan.
